POSITION SUMMARY

Inspect, identify and control all plant pests and pathogens for all assigned horticulture areas. Mix and apply pest control materials. Maintain accurate records of inspections and locations, amounts and types of pest control material utilized in course of assigned tasks to promote compliance with State and Federal regulations. Provide training to Horticulture staff in regard to pest management and plant materials. Maintain and repair equipment required to perform assigned pest control tasks. Provide bird and rodent control for the property as assigned. Perform plant wash down and cleaning as assigned. Assist with the removal and installation of plant material as assigned. Perform soil analysis and apply soil amendments including, but not limited to fertilizers, lime and new soil as assigned

Essential Job Functions and requirements of the Pest Control Technician:

  • Knowledge of pests, rodents, and other vermin.
  • Knowledge of pest control products, services, treatments, regulations, and safety procedures.
  • Ability to operate a motor vehicle.
  • Ability to enter/exit structures and crawl spaces, climb over and on top of structures, ascend and descend stairs and ladders.
  • Ability to use required personal protective equipment.
  • Ability to visually inspect for pests, pest entries, etc.
  • Ability to tolerate variety of environmental conditions, including seasonal weather, damp and/or dusty locations.
  • Follows all JP McHale Pest Management Company policies, procedures and guidelines.
  • Follows OSHA/FIFRA policies and procedures when carrying out pest control services.
  • Operates company vehicle safely; and maintains vehicle to comply with DOT and company guidelines.
  • Completes services as scheduled and provides appropriate documentation of services performed.
  • Reports and paperwork are thorough, accurate, legible, and on time.
  • Acts quickly and effectively to address actual or potential problems.
  • The ability to meet the physical demands of the job; walking, bending, kneeling, climbing, lifting & carrying up to 40 lbs., etc.
